Reviewer 2 Report

In the manuscript (materials-1534153), the authors studied the effects of fabric structure and raw materials on moisture content of the skin. However, there is not sufficient background information and sufficient literature examples in the introduction, the introduction section can be improved with recent examples. The citations throughout the manuscript can not be viewed, there is an error "Error! Reference source not found.." Conversely, the "Materials and Methods" section is too long and difficult to follow. The language used in explaining the methods sounds like a user's guide. As an example, in line 109 "Mark the measuring area 5cm away from the palm on the inner side of the 109 arm, and the test area is 3cm × 3cm, mark with both left and right hands." should be changed to "The measuring area was marked 5 cm away from the palm...." The number of figures is too high for a materials and methods section, for instance the figures of the apparatus are not necessary.  However, there are not enough figures in results and discussion part. Results and discussion section is shorter than materials and methods section, which is very uncommon. The results given are presented as tables, which is not easy compare, i would prefer graphical presentation so that readers can compare the differences based on fabric type and structure. I would also prefer to see more visual data rather than just numbers, which would increase the quality of the paper, such as imaging the epidermis with a microscope, because the authors defend that these fabrics reduce skin dryness. In Table 6, it must be clearly stated what are 25:75, 50:50, 75:25 and 100:0, at least in the caption. In Figure 7, the x axis is not clearly presented enough. In line 243, the authors claimed that 1+1 mock rib fabric showed stronger thermal insulation performance, how was this measured? The quality of writing should also be improved in results and discussions. There are some very long sentences in the text, it can be a good idea to divide them in two sentences which would be easier to understand for the readers (such as line 225-230, 279-282). I am glad to reconsider the revised version then.

Reviewer 2 Report

I thank the authors for the modifications in the manuscript. However, i still think the introduction is insufficient. There are not sufficient background from recent works on the use of hyaluronic acid in textiles and moisture content of textiles. The most recent examples given by the authors are from 2009-2017, but there are more recent studies which should be cited. The novelty of this paper is not clearly described. The results presented are still confusing, i suggest the authors to divide veil raw materials and weaving ratio into two seperate columns in Table 3, 5 and 9. The x axis of the graph (Figure 5) is still missing and the values on x axis are not corrected. The results are disorganized, for example i think line 381-384 should come after line 354-355. The flow of information is broken. "From the fabric structure" and "from the raw materials" subtitles can be removed from the results and discussion part for a more continuous flow. This point of view can be added to the conclusions, the results can be summarized from the point of the fabric structure and raw materials in the conclusion part. I still think some other type of data would contribute to the manuscript.
